Why this rating

This daycare earned 4 out of 5 stars overall. Structural quality reflects an 86% violation rate, no complaints on record, and a license in good standing. The structural rating also includes California's licensing baseline — what every licensed daycare in the state must meet. California caps infant ratios at 1:4, toddler ratios at 1:6, and preschool ratios at 1:12. Lead teachers must hold a High School Diploma. Annual training isn't required by the state. No objective process measures (e.g., state quality rating or national accreditation) are available for this daycare. The overall rating reflects structural features only.

Inspection History

3 Inspection Visits Since 2021 · 5 Findings
5 Important

Across 3 inspections since 2021, the issues cited most often were Staff Qualifications & Background Checks (3) and Licensing & Administrative Compliance (2). None of the 5 findings were critical.

See All 3 Inspection Visits
  1. Feb 8, 20242 Findings2 Important
    • Disaster and Mass Casualty Plan (D) Disaster Drills Shall Be Conducted at Least Every Six Months. This Requirement Is Not Met as Evidenced By:CCR 101174(d)

      At 11:30AM., Based on record review and interview, LPA confirmed facility has not conducted required emergency drill within the last 6 months. This poses a potential health and safety risk to children in care. POC Due Date: 02/12/2024

    • Responsibility for Providing Care and Supervision for Infants (C) Documentation Shall Be Maintained in the Infant’s File and Be Available to the Department for Review.…CCR 101429(a)(2)(C)(4)

      At 11:20AM, Based on record review and interview, LPA confirmed staff are not documenting infant napping conditions during each 15 minute review. This poses a potential health and safety risk to children in care. POC Due Date: 02/12/2024

  2. Oct 12, 20222 Findings2 Important
    • Staff-Infant Ratio (B) There Shall Be a Ratio of One Teacher for Every Four Infants in Attendance. This Requirement Is Not Met as Evidenced By:CCR 101416.5(b)

      Based on observations and record review conducted, LPA confirmed infant classroom was not in proper teacher- child ratio, with no qualified teacher present. This poses a potential health and safety risk to children in care. POC Due Date: 10/19/2022

    • Responsibility for Providing Care and Supervision for Infants (C) Documentation Shall Be Maintained in the Infant’s File and Be Available to the Department for Review.…CCR 101429(a)(2)(C)

      Based on interview and record review, LPA confirmed staff is not maintaining infant napping logs, documenting each 15- minute check. This poses a potential health and safety risk to children in care. POC Due Date: 10/21/2022
